Recording with the external
microphone connected to the
XLR/TRS jack(s)

You can connect an external microphone
(commercially available) to the XLR/TRS jack
on the linear PCM recorder and use it for
recording.

1

Slide the phantom power switch(es)
to “OFF.”

2

Connect an external microphone to
the XLR/TRS jack(s) on the linear PCM
recorder.

To record in stereo, connect the microphone
to both of the XLR/TRS jacks for the left (L)
and right (R) channels.
To record in monaural, connect it to the
XLR/TRS jack for the left (L) channel.
Adjust the position of the microphone.
For the characteristics of the microphone,
refer to the operating instructions supplied
with it.

3

Slide the INPUT switch to “XLR/TRS.”

4

Slide the XLR/TRS INPUT LEVEL switch
to “MIC.”

When the microphone is connected to
both of the XLR/TRS jacks for the left
(L) and right (R) channels, slide both of
the switches for the left (L) and right (R)
channels.

5

If the connected external microphone
supports phantom power, slide the
phantom power switch(es) to “ON.”

Power is supplied to the connected
microphone.

6

Follow steps 3 through 7 in “Recording
using the built-in microphones” (page
31) t
o start recording.

7

To record in monaural, press the
OPTION button while recording is
on standby to display the OPTION
menu, select “Stereo/Monaural”

“Monaural (L),” and then press the

button.
